When Adren Veachel Silvey was born on 18 April 1903, in Logan, Kentucky, United States, his father, Charles Oscar Silvey, was 29 and his mother, Ollie Alice Baugh, was 25. He married Eva Mae Beadnell about 1928. They were the parents of at least 1 daughter. He lived in Supervisorial District 1, Cochise, Arizona, United States in 1940 and Lowell, Cochise, Arizona, United States for about 1 years. He died on 1 July 1969, in Vail, Pima, Arizona, United States, at the age of 66, and was buried in Evergreen Cemetery, Bisbee, Cochise, Arizona, United States.

From 1904-1909, the Black Patch War took place. This was a war between about 30 counties in southwestern Kentucky and northwestern Tennessee. The war was mostly over the Dark Fired Tobacco that was produced in the area during this time.

English: perhaps from the Middle English personal name Silveyn, with loss of final -n; see Selwyn 2. In North America, this surname is also an altered form of the variant Selvy .
